Transaction 512693680dbf41f87b005a6e9f526893e396f90ae5cd7d009901d9a8439d8222

3 Input
1 Outputs
  • 512693680dbf41f87b005a6e9f526893e396f90ae5cd7d009901d9a8439d8222:0
  • value  352937
    address  3FukPxB9gHhryC14bge1XK46FpjvM8Wf9d